## A short Historical past of E book Printing
Book printing has occur a good distance considering the fact that its inception. Before printing presses, books were hand-copied by scribes, making them costly and rare. The sport-transforming minute in ebook printing historical past came within the 15th century when Johannes Gutenberg invented the movable-style printing push. This creation revolutionized the market by permitting mass production of books, making them extra available to the general public.
Given that then, printing technology has progressed drastically, with modern day electronic and offset printing procedures generating guide production a lot quicker, extra productive, and price-powerful.
Kinds of E book Printing Strategies
There are 3 main printing procedures used in ebook production: **offset printing, digital printing, and print-on-desire (POD)**. Every single approach has its pros and is also acceptable for different wants.
1. Offset Printing
Offset printing is the traditional and most widely made use of technique for developing books in huge portions. It involves transferring ink from a steel plate to your rubber blanket and after that onto paper.
Professionals:
- Significant-quality prints with crisp photographs and textual content.
- Cost-powerful for giant print operates (typically 500+ copies).
- Far more paper options and finishes.
Negatives:
- High First set up charges.
- Not ideal for smaller print runs mainly because of the Price tag per device.
2. Digital Printing
Electronic printing is a newer technique that prints directly from a digital file without the need to have for printing plates. This is often perfect for smaller to medium print operates.
Execs:
- Reduce upfront prices.
- More rapidly turnaround time.
- Ideal for limited runs (ten–five hundred copies).
Downsides:
- Increased Value for every device in comparison to offset printing.
- Minimal paper possibilities.
3. Print-on-Need (POD)
POD is really a form of digital printing that prints textbooks only when an buy is positioned. This technique is well known amongst self-publishers who do not want to maintain inventory.
Professionals:
- No must retail outlet huge quantities of publications.
- Reduced economic risk.
- Speedy printing and shipping and delivery.
Disadvantages:
- Bigger printing fees for every e-book.
- Confined customization possibilities.
- Lower income margins.
Paper and Ink Options in Ebook Printing
The selection of paper and ink affects the overall high-quality, search, and sense in the e book. Comprehending these elements may help you make educated conclusions.
Paper Kinds
- Uncoated Paper: Finest for novels and textbooks mainly because it is straightforward to examine and absorbs ink nicely.
- Coated Paper: Perfect for books with photos, for example images guides and magazines, as it enhances colour vibrancy.
- Recycled Paper: An eco-helpful possibility that appeals to environmentally conscious readers.
Paper Bodyweight
Paper fat is calculated in GSM (grams for every sq. meter). The upper the GSM, the thicker the paper.
- **70–eighty GSM**: Standard for novels and fiction books.
- **100–130 GSM**: Ideal for books with photos and non-fiction.
- **150+ GSM**: Employed for high-conclude images guides and artwork publications.
### Ink Options
- **C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black)**: Utilized for total-shade printing.
- Black Ink: The most typical and value-helpful option for textual content-dependent textbooks.
- Location Colors: Used for branding consistency, notably in corporation products.
Binding Selections for Books
Binding plays an important purpose in the sturdiness and overall look of a ebook. Various binding techniques fit differing types of textbooks.
1. Fantastic Binding
- Typical for paperback books.
- Utilizes glue to bind pages to the quilt.
- Very affordable but a lot less sturdy than other strategies.
2. Scenario Binding (Hardcover)
- Substantial-high-quality binding useful for high quality textbooks.
- The pages are sewn together and glued right into a challenging deal with.
- Long lasting and Specialist-looking.
3. Saddle Stitching
- Useful for booklets and Publications with much less webpages.
- Stapled through the fold in the middle on the guide.
4. Spiral and Wire-O Binding
- Best for workbooks and manuals that must lay flat.
- Employs a spiral or wire to hold the internet pages collectively.
5. Smyth Sewing
- Quite possibly the most long lasting binding system.
- Pages are sewn jointly just before currently being glued right into a hardcover.
- Ideal for superior-end books.
Expense Criteria in E-book Printing
Printing charges rely upon numerous things, which includes the quantity of copies, printing process, paper quality, and binding kind. Here’s how you can enhance expenditures:
one. Choose the Suitable Printing System – Offset printing is most effective for giant print operates, even though digital and POD printing work nicely for tiny quantities.
2. Optimize Webpage Count – Cutting down blank web pages and optimizing text structure may help decrease expenses.
three. Find Charge-Productive Paper – Larger GSM paper is more expensive; choose an correct body weight to your book sort.
4. Take into account Regular Measurements – Customized dimensions boost costs. Common guide dimensions assist lower waste and costs.
five. Order in Bulk – The fee per device decreases when buying in much larger quantities.
Guidelines for top-Excellent Book Printing
Obtaining a superior-good quality printed e-book involves notice to element and correct organizing. Here are a few strategies:
one. Use Superior-Resolution Pictures – Low-high quality pictures result in blurry or pixelated prints. Ensure all visuals are at least 300 DPI.
2. Proofread Totally – Typos and formatting mistakes is usually high-priced to fix just after printing. Constantly proofread prior to sending your e-book to print.
three. Function with knowledgeable Printer – Knowledgeable printing providers can manual you through the method and provide improved high quality benefits.
four. Request a Print Proof – A sample copy assists you Examine shades, paper high-quality, and structure in advance of committing to an entire print operate.
5. Comprehend Bleed and Margins – Guarantee text and essential design and style factors are inside Secure margins to prevent getting Slash off.
